Electric Wonders Will Be On Show

May 4th, 1896
Page number(s):
5

National Exposition Opens To-Day in the Grand Central Industrial Building.

INVENTORS’ CONTRIBUTIONS.

Governor Morton, by Touching a Button, Will Discharge Artillery in Four Distant Cities.

A MESSAGE ROUND THE WORLD

Several hundred men have been at work night and day for the last week making elaborate preparation for to-night’s opening ceremony of the National Exposition of Electrical Appliances. The exposition is held under the auspices of the same organization which made the display at the World’s Fair, and is incidental to the tenth annual Convention of the National Electric Light Association. Delegates present will represent nearly ten thousand electric lighting plants in the United States, with an aggregate investment of $750,000,000.

ELECTRICAL EXPOSITION TO OPEN TONIGHT.

Governor Morton will, in the Industrial Arts Building, Forty-third street and Lexington avenue, at eight o’clock, deliver a short address and then turn on a current of electricity generated by the falls of Niagara and put in operation the machinery in the exposition building. This will be the longest transmission of electricity for power purposes ever perfected, the line being 462 miles in length. The only line approaching it in length was one of 110 miles in Germany. The Governor will use the same golden key with which President Cleveland started the wheels in the great World’s Fair.

ARTILLERY FIRED BY TELEGRAPH.

Another incident will be the discharge of four pieces of ordnance by Governor Morton by telegraph. With the consent of the War Department at Washington companies of artillery at San Francisco, New Orleans, Augusta, Me., and St. Paul will place guns in the public parks, which will be connected by suitable mechanism with the lines. As the Governor declares the exposition duly opened he will press a button which will discharge these pieces of artillery.

The current from Niagara will be used in turning a model of the great power plant recently completed at Niagara Falls. The model shows a section of the city of Niagara, with the river and islands and Canadian shore. On either side of the model will be twenty-four telephone transmitters, the receivers of which, placed at the brink of the falls at Niagara, enable those witnessing the movements of the machinery to hear the roar of the cataract. The current will also put in operation a miniature model of a section of the Erie Canal, along which a cableway line is shown, bearing a motor electrically operated and towing a fleet of three steel canalboats. The canalboats are exact models of the new design built in Cleveland, Ohio.

DEPEW’S MESSAGE ROUND THE WORLD.

A feature during the exposition will be the sending of a telegram by Dr. Chauncey M. Depew around the world, or as nearly so as may be. On one side of the gallery will be a table, with telegraphic instruments for sending. In the opposite gallery will be a table, with receiving instruments. From the one Dr. Depew will start his cablegram, addressed to Edward D. Adams, the president of the Niagara Power Company, who, on receiving it, will read it to those present. He will thereupon send his reply, which will be read by Dr. Depew, and followed by a brief address.

Through the courtesy of Sir W. H. Preece, chief of the British government lines, this circuit of the globe is made, and it will be the longest circuit over which a current of electricity has ever been sent. On a canvas in the rear of the hall will be shown the exact route of the cable message around the world: — From New York to Canso, to Lisbon, under the Mediterranean Sea to Suez, along the line of the famous canal, under the Red Sea to Aden, thence to Bombay, across the land line to India, to Madras, to Singapore, to Northern Australia, Melbourne and Sydney. The return is by cable to the Cape of Good Hope, thence along the African coast to Lisbon, crossing the Atlantic again to Pernambuco, Brazil, thence to Mexico, to San Francisco and across the continent to New York.

A feature of interest in connection with the exposition will be the sending of a message of congratulation to Her Majesty the Queen on her birthday, May 24, the current to be used being generated by the waters of the Niagara River, which are international.

TESLA’S TEN MILLION VOLTAGE.

One of the most astonishing things which will be shown will be Nikola Tesla’s oscillator, by means of which he is able to develop a current of 10,000,000 voltage. So enormous is this power that nothing has been discovered to which it can be applied, and yet he declares that it is practically harmless, the method of transmission being so regulated that it will not kill. The popular understanding, as based upon the electrical chambers of the State prisons, is that 1,700 volts will kill. Besides this, Mr. Tesla will show a model of the machine by means of which he may be able to do away with metallic circuits in telegraphing. All he will have to do is to signal Singapore, and Singapore will answer without the medium of telegraphic wires or ocean cables. The development of this machine, Mr. Tesla says, may enable us to communicate with the stars, though no experiments to that end will be conducted during the exposition. Then he will show his experiments in the application of his principles regarding electrical vibrations, by means of which electrical lighting will be revolutionized, and instead of carbons and filaments, the vacuums of the bulbs will be filled with an electric glow like that of sunlight, and as steady as the light of noonday.

EDISON’S FLUOROSCOPE.

Mr. Edison’s division of the exhibition will include all of his inventions affecting telegraphy, telephony, lighting, phonographs and the combinations which he has effected with the camera and stereopticon. But the thing which will probably most deeply interest the majority of those who visit his section will be his adaptation of the X rays to practical use by means of the fluoroscope. There will be four of these instruments, and those persons who believe that their hands or arms contain matter sufficiently interesting for examination will be given ample opportunity to satisfy themselves. Mr. Edison has given the exhibition managers the privilege of helping themselves to anything they may find of interest in his laboratory, and he has assigned a number of his assistants to duty in the building, so that inquirers may be fully informed on any subject about which they may express curiosity.

There will be an electrical kitchen, where all the cooking is done without kindling a fire, and where a steak may be broiled or a pot of coffee made by merely turning a switch; telephone central office in full operation, with the “Hello girls” hard at work; inventions affecting street and heavy railway transportation, electric lighting, telegraphy and telephony and all the other manifold uses to which electricity has been applied. There will be no one thing which has marked an advance in the science which will not be either in the commercial part of the show or in the exhibitions of Cornell and Columbia universities.

At the Industrial Arts Building at ten minutes past ten o’clock last night a preliminary test was made of the transmission of power from Niagara Falls over an ordinary wire by the Tesla system. The test was in every way successful and developed more efficiency than was anticipated. There was a loss of less than thirty per cent. Three hundred and fifty volts were transmitted.

NIAGARA CURRENT TRIED WITHOUT TRANSFORMERS AT HIGH VOLTAGE.

(BY TELEGRAPH TO THE HERALD.)

NIAGARA FALLS, N. Y., May 3, 1896. — The first experiment in the sending of Niagara power to the New York Electrical Exposition was made late last night, when power at 200 voltage, alternating current, was sent. To-night the voltage was raised to 350, and again sent. Until the new transformers of the company arrive, however, it is not expected the best results can be obtained.
